WIKI使用導(dǎo)航
站長百科導(dǎo)航
站長專題
- 網(wǎng)站推廣
- 網(wǎng)站程序
- 網(wǎng)站賺錢
- 虛擬主機
- cPanel
- 網(wǎng)址導(dǎo)航專題
- 云計算
- 微博營銷
- 虛擬主機管理系統(tǒng)
- 開放平臺
- WIKI程序與應(yīng)用
- 美國十大主機
ECMS:系統(tǒng)模型結(jié)合項
來自站長百科
導(dǎo)航: 上一級 | 帝國CMS | 首頁 | DedeCMS | Drupal | PHPCMS | PHP168 | Xoops | Joomla | PowerEasy | SupeSite
為了使信息列表可實現(xiàn)按多種條件輸出數(shù)據(jù),EmpireCMS引入了可設(shè)置無限條件的模型結(jié)合項功能。
結(jié)合項的語法說明:
e/action/ListInfo?classid=欄目ID&ph=1&字段名1=值1&字段名2=值2......&字段名N=值N
- 欄目動態(tài)列表下使用結(jié)合項(有選擇列表模板的欄目都可以使用動態(tài)列表鏈接[父欄目與終極欄目均可]);
- “ph=1”為聲名要使用結(jié)合項;
- “字段名”必須為后臺系統(tǒng)模型選擇的結(jié)合項字段;
- 結(jié)合項字段可為數(shù)據(jù)表的所有字段,并且多個字段之間的關(guān)系是“并且(and)”;
- 結(jié)合項有兩種匹配方式:完全匹配則為值完全相等即可符合;模糊匹配則為包含字符即可符合。
舉例說明:以信息分類為例(其它系統(tǒng)模型也是一樣的設(shè)置)。
- 如下圖中,我們在系統(tǒng)模型中開啟了“所在地”與“聯(lián)系郵箱”為結(jié)合項。
- 假設(shè)“e/action/ListInfo/?classid=9”顯示出的是所有信息分類欄目的數(shù)據(jù)。
列出所在地為“昌平區(qū)”的所有信息
列出所在地為“昌平區(qū)”,并且聯(lián)系郵箱是“ts@abc.com”的所有信息
附加說明:上面舉例的是選擇完全匹配方式,也可以選擇模糊匹配方式,模糊匹配則只要包含字符值即可符合條件。例:“e/action/ListInfo/?classid=9&ph=1&email=abc.com”就能列出郵箱地址中包含“abc.com”字符的的所有分類信息。